Short Term Bad Credit Loans
Individuals suffering from bad credit could face some problems when trying to find out anyone disposed to loan them
money, because of the risk that customers might default on the repayments. Moneylenders happily offer loans to individuals who have an employment, no pending credit bills or arrears and a
favorable credit score. Though, if you are self-employed, have pending bills or a bad credit rating, you will probably find it hard to obtain a loan, whether it be a personal loan, an
unsecured loan, a car loan or a home loan.
There are two types of Short Term Loans
There are two primary types of loans. An unsecured loan often known as signature loan and that requires no collateral.
This entails that you do not need to pledge any property of yours, such as a car or your house, as a guarantee. On the other hand, a secured loan requires collateral. This is the sort of
financing availed to acquire large or expensive objects, such as furniture, jewelry, cars, or your own home. If the borrower defaults or stops meeting payments, the purchased items might
be retrieved.
Payday loans are other type of short term bad credit loans. In a payday loan, if your application is approved, the borrowed
money is credited into your bank account. Usually the owed sum is taken from your bank account, unless a payment is completed in advance. The interest rate on this form of financing
alternative is obviously elevated. The fact is that these lenders provide this type of short term bad credit loan to people who have no other funding alternatives to facing an urgent
situation, because of their bad credit or pending arrears, which involve a high risk for the lender, hence the high fees and interest rates applied to this kind of loan.
